Nollywood’s ‘Anu’ set for TINFF global premiere

Bush Doctor Studios’ debut feature film, Anu, has been selected for the Toronto International Nollywood Film Festival (TINFF), where it will have its world premiere in Toronto, Canada.

The Nigerian production company announced the development on its social media platforms, urging movie lovers to look out for the emotionally gripping revenge thriller.

Directed by Temitope Jude Egwu and co-directed by Wale Ilebiyi, Anu is scheduled to premiere in September as part of the festival’s lineup of films from Nigeria and other parts of the world.

Following its festival run, the film is expected to be released on selected streaming platforms.

The movie boasts an ensemble cast of established Nollywood actors, including the late Alwell Ademola, Peters Ijagbemi, Wale Ilebiyi, Sola Kosoko and Toyin Alausa.

It also provides a platform for a new generation of actors, featuring Joshua Jinad, Daniel Adeshina, Rita Okonne, Oyinlola Opeyemi, Bazok John Abidemi and Obinna D Gabriel, among others.

Speaking on his long-term vision for Bush Doctor Studios and its place in the Nigerian film industry, the company’s founder, Temitope Jude Egwu, said the goal is to create films that leave a lasting impression on audiences.

“The dream is to create art that captivates, thrills and entertains audiences for generations to come,” he said.
